Automated Ultrasound Doppler Angle Estimation Using Deep Learning
Published in 41st Annual International Conference of the IEEE Engineering in Medicine and Biology Society (EMBC), 2019
A convolutional model that takes B-mode ultrasound frames and estimates the Doppler insonation angle automatically. Doppler velocity measurements are only meaningful relative to the vessel orientation; removing the manual angle-marking step makes scanning faster and reduces operator-to-operator variance. Validated against expert-labeled angles across a held-out scan set.
